About this plant
The Kay Parris Southern Magnolia (Magnolia grandiflora 'Kay Parris') offers all the grandeur of its Southern Magnolia parent in a more manageable, compact size. This premium cultivar boasts exceptionally glossy, dark green leaves with captivating, rusty-brown undersides, providing year-round interest and a sophisticated backdrop to any landscape. From late spring through summer, 'Kay Parris' adorns itself with exquisite, large, creamy-white flowers that exude a powerful, sweet fragrance. These iconic blooms, often up to 8 inches across, stand out majestically against the dark foliage, making it a focal point in any garden setting. Its naturally dense, pyramidal growth habit requires minimal pruning, ensuring an elegant profile. Care & maintenance
Prefers rich, well-draining, acidic soil. Water regularly during establishment and periods of drought. Mulch around the base to retain moisture and regulate soil temperature. Minimal pruning is required, primarily to remove dead or crossing branches. Protect from harsh winter winds in colder zones.
Quick facts
- Type
- evergreen
- Mature height
- 20-30 feet
- Mature width
- 10-15 feet
- Sun
- Full Sun to Partial Shade
- Water
- Medium to High
- Growth rate
- Medium
